About the Role

We are seeking a highly skilled Radiology Technician to join our team in the fertility industry.

We are looking for someone to learn to perform HSGs.

A hysterosalpingogram (HSG) is a diagnostic X-ray procedure to examine the inside of the uterus, and fallopian tubes, typically to investigate infertility, recurrent miscarriages, or to check for tubal blockages.

As a Radiology Technician, you will be responsible for performing diagnostic imaging procedures, including X-rays, in a clinical setting.

Your primary focus will be on ensuring radiation safety and minimizing radiation exposure to patients and staff.

You will also be responsible for producing high-quality radiography images and maintaining accurate patient records.

Your role will be critical in providing quality patient care and contributing to the overall success of our organization.

Market context

Radiology tech roles remain steady in New Jersey

Radiology Technician roles in New Jersey are typically supported by ongoing demand in hospitals, outpatient imaging centers, and specialty practices. Competition often centers on candidates with fluoroscopy experience, current certification, and familiarity with PACS and RIS, since these skills help teams keep imaging workflows efficient.
